Abstract

The invention relates to a method for recovering and refining yellow phosphorus by phosphorus sludge. The method comprises the following steps: heating protective gas, pressuring the protective gas as a phosphorus sludge vaporization heat source, sending the protective gas in a vaporization tower and performing reversed hedge with the phosphorus sludge sent by a phosphorus sludge pump, removing dust in phosphorus steam by a dust-removing device, sending the material in a chilling tower, using water for washing and chilling, preparing a yellow phosphorus product, sending gas in a cooling tower, using water for washing and cooling, recovering the residual yellow phosphorus product, and returning the protective gas to a heater for recycling. According to the characteristic that the phosphorus sludge cannot contact with air, the protective gas is heated and pressured, then is taken as the phosphorus sludge vaporization heat source, the protective gas is recycled, and energy conservation and environment protection are realized; the dust-removing device can thoroughly separate the ash and yellow phosphorus in the phosphorus sludge, the purity of the yellow phosphorus product is increased; the method has the advantages of tight process, continuous and automatic operation, and environmental protection and safety, the production efficiency is greatly increased, the recovery rate of the yellow phosphorus product reaches more than 99%, the pipeline pressure testing and centrifugal fan running realize interconnected control, and the production safety is increased.

Technical background
Mud phosphorus is the waste residue formed during phosphorus production, is made up of element phosphor, dust impurities and water, belongs to dangerous solid waste in phosphorus chemistry industry, produces 1 ton of yellow phosphorus and about produce the mud phosphorus of about 0.3 ton.Processing of mud phosphorus deepens continuously the problem inquired into utilizing always phosphorus production enterprise, and it not only affects the response rate and the production cost of phosphorus during yellow phosphorus industry produces, more likely causes serious environmental pollution.Effectively process and compared with this phosphorus-containing waste slag of good utilisation, be possible not only to better profit from limited phosphate rock resource, improve the response rate of phosphorus, reduce production cost, and its pollution to environment can be eliminated.
Reclaiming refined yellow phosphorus from mud phosphorus is effectively to process and the optimum selection of relatively good utilisation mud phosphorus.Physical of the prior art is to utilize U-shaped pot vaporizer or revolution phosphorus-steaming pot, mud phosphorus heating evaporation is become phosphorous steam, then obtains yellow phosphorus product by washing.Use this technology can realize the device of continuous operation few, and vacuum filtration and filter by phosphorus steam self effusion and all there is pipeline and easily block, cause the potential safety hazard of vaporising device blast.CN203065160 discloses a kind of continuous high-efficient environmental protection phosphorous slurry recovery device, fed from U-shaped pot vaporizer front end by screw(-type) feeder, use combustion gas external heat U-shaped pot vaporizer, in U-shaped pot vaporizer, crutcher is set, phosphorus steam escapes from the top of U-shaped pot evaporator back end, and waste residue is discharged from the bottom of U-shaped pot evaporator back end.This device only provides the content that mud phosphorus heating evaporation becomes phosphorous steam, do not only exist mud phosphorus be heated uneven, unload slag charge difficulty and the low problem of environmental safety, and there is no follow-up flow process, solve pipeline the most at all and easily block, cause the potential safety hazard of vaporising device blast.CN1962418 discloses a kind of mud phosphor recovery and refining method, it adds in mud phosphorus and includes ammonium chloride, silicon dioxide, after the dispersant of kieselguhr and magnesium silicate, mud phosphorus is put into revolution phosphorus-steaming pot and burns steaming, the thick phosphorus collected is respectively at phosphorus-melting groove, refinery pit and pan tank rinse with steam for three times, prepare finished phosphorus, the party's chemical method of the prior art owned by France, not only increase consumption of raw and auxiliary materials, production process is formed new garbage, process the most relatively costly, do not process, cause secondary pollution, and the method is intermittent operation, production efficiency is low, extremely difficult realize closed-loop operation, harm workers ' health, environmental safety is low.
Summary of the invention
A kind of method that it is an object of the invention to provide mud phosphor recovery and refining yellow phosphorus; its thermal source that will vaporize as mud phosphorus after protective gas heating, pressurization; the phosphorous steam removing dust device dedusting of vaporization; yellow phosphorus is reclaimed after quenching column cooling, cooling; gas makes temperature be reduced to room temperature through cooling tower again, and the gas after cooling reclaims and uses.The method effectively overcomes the defect that prior art exists, it is proposed that a kind of safe and environment-friendly, cleaning, the new technical scheme of yellow phosphorus continuously and in high efficiente callback mud phosphorus.
The present invention is achieved through the following technical solutions:
A kind of method of mud phosphor recovery and refining yellow phosphorus, mud phosphorus heating evaporation is become phosphorous steam, removing dust equipment dedusting, again with the phosphorous steam of water wash cooling, make yellow phosphorus product, it is with the prominent distinction of prior art: send into centrifugal blower after protective gas is heated to 500~600 DEG C, protective gas is forced into after 0.1~0.15MPa by centrifugal blower sends into the mud phosphorus reversed hedge come in vaporization tower with the pumping of mud phosphorus, after gained phosphorous steam removing dust equipment dedusting, send into quenching column, wash Quench with water to gas phase temperature≤80 DEG C, prepare yellow phosphorus product, gas sends into cooling tower, again wash with water and be cooled to room temperature, receive residue yellow phosphorus product to the greatest extent, protective gas heater return recycles.
Protective gas includes nitrogen, carbon dioxide and noble gas, is optimal with nitrogen or carbon dioxide.
In production practices, the port of export of vaporization tower and cleaner is mounted on pressure transducer, and with centrifugal blower interlocked control, phosphorous gas is when blocking occurs in gas phase pipeline, the pipeline pressure signal raised can be detected and be sent to the master control set of centrifugal blower immediately, after this master control set will differentiate safely according to data, is automatically turned off centrifugal blower, stop vaporization tower and cleaner and easily blocked because of pipeline, and cause the potential safety hazard of blast.
The present invention fully takes into account mud phosphorus creatively can not vaporize thermal source as mud phosphorus with the feature of air contact after protective gas heating, pressurization, and protective gas recycles, energy-conserving and environment-protective;Lime-ash in mud phosphorus can be separated thoroughly by cleaner used with yellow phosphorus, and yellow phosphorus product purity improves;Overall process is airtight, continuous, automation mechanized operation, and environmental safety is high, and production efficiency is greatly improved, and the response rate of yellow phosphorus product up to >=99%, pipeline pressure detection carries out interlocked control with centrifugal blower operation, further increases the safety of production.

Embodiment 1: a kind of method of mud phosphor recovery and refining yellow phosphorus, centrifugal blower is sent into after nitrogen or carbon dioxide are heated to 500~530 DEG C, protective gas is forced into after 0.1~0.12MPa by centrifugal blower sends into the mud phosphorus reversed hedge come in vaporization tower with the pumping of mud phosphorus, after gained phosphorous steam removing dust equipment dedusting, send into quenching column, wash Quench with water to gas phase temperature≤70 DEG C, prepare yellow phosphorus product, gas sends into cooling tower, again wash with water and be cooled to room temperature, receive residue yellow phosphorus product to the greatest extent, protective gas heater return recycles, the yellow phosphorus response rate in mud phosphorus is 99.15%.
Embodiment 2: a kind of method of mud phosphor recovery and refining yellow phosphorus, centrifugal blower is sent into after nitrogen or carbon dioxide are heated to 530~560 DEG C, protective gas is forced into after 0.12~0.14MPa by centrifugal blower sends into the mud phosphorus reversed hedge come in vaporization tower with the pumping of mud phosphorus, after gained phosphorous steam removing dust equipment dedusting, send into quenching column, wash Quench with water to gas phase temperature≤75 DEG C, prepare yellow phosphorus product, gas sends into cooling tower, again wash with water and be cooled to room temperature, receive residue yellow phosphorus product to the greatest extent, protective gas heater return recycles, the yellow phosphorus response rate in mud phosphorus is 99.3%.
Embodiment 3: a kind of method of mud phosphor recovery and refining yellow phosphorus, centrifugal blower is sent into after nitrogen or carbon dioxide are heated to 560~600 DEG C, protective gas is forced into after 0.14~0.15MPa by centrifugal blower sends into the mud phosphorus reversed hedge come in vaporization tower with the pumping of mud phosphorus, after gained phosphorous steam removing dust equipment dedusting, send into quenching column, wash Quench with water to gas phase temperature≤80 DEG C, prepare yellow phosphorus product, gas sends into cooling tower, again wash with water and be cooled to room temperature, receive residue yellow phosphorus product to the greatest extent, protective gas heater return recycles, the yellow phosphorus response rate in mud phosphorus is 99.4%.
